The turbolift serves as a psychological battleground where Riker’s sanity is tested. Its confined space amplifies his isolation, making the hallucination of the asylum corridor feel even more intrusive. The turbolift’s movement between decks mirrors Riker’s internal struggle to navigate between reality and illusion. When the doors reveal the asylum corridor, the turbolift briefly becomes a portal to his fractured psyche, forcing him to confront the Tilonians’ manipulation head-on.
